IPN突然没有发送'transaction_subject'字段

时间:2013-07-26 09:09:19

标签: paypal paypal-ipn

我的IPN实施已经触及了大约四年,并且在所有这些时间里都运行良好。但上周出于某种原因,我似乎没有收到IPN回调中的'transaction_subject'字段值。有没有其他人经历过这个或者知道为什么会这样?

编辑:以下是我收到的IPN帖子,根据 PayPal_Patrick的要求

transaction_subject=
payment_date=21:49:54 Jul 28, 2013 PDT
txn_type=web_accept
last_name=REMOVED
residence_country=CA
item_name=REMOVED
payment_gross=
mc_currency=EUR
business=REMOVED
payment_type=instant
protection_eligibility=Ineligible
verify_sign=ARriB6IyMnFnOvenXyPlH5ooAOIEApSrdcUfoH0hyHiEqIC3.Gi5ojme
payer_status=verified
tax=0.00
payer_email=REMOVED
txn_id=67U74048Y42181247
quantity=1
receiver_email=REMOVED
first_name=REMOVED
payer_id=DHYR5X5ZHELCS
receiver_id=WAABZ68SWASH6
item_number=dbe8ee8e-6074-4e00-92ff-8d2f6f4bc329
handling_amount=0.00
payment_status=Completed
payment_fee=
mc_fee=0.78
shipping=0.00
mc_gross=10.95
custom=
charset=windows-1252
notify_version=3.7
ipn_track_id=75aecc60512bd

4 个答案:

答案 0 :(得分:1)

我遇到了同样的问题。在几年没有任何问题的情况下工作之后,transaction_subject值在7月24日开始是空的(它在前一天工作)。 那天PayPal改变了什么?

答案 1 :(得分:1)

我发现了导致问题的系统问题。我建议创建一张票 - 在这里:PayPal.com/mts - 并使用票号为该线程添加评论。

答案 2 :(得分:1)

我遇到了同样的问题!很烦人。我使用transaction_subject作为确定它是否是可计费购物车交易的一种方式。因此,这种消失使我对我工作的公司的账单搞砸了。非常糟糕。

但是有一个解决方案!

'txn_type'字段似乎运行良好,并没有出现问题。我回顾了IPN日志以发现它并检查它的过去行为。我调整了我的系统来改用它。

答案 3 :(得分:0)

我们的一个客户网站随机启动此问题。我们从未弄清楚为什么paypal停止发回这些信息,但我们注意到相同的信息可以通过" custom"现场送回。